IntroductionA major role of a leader in an organization is to lead the employees to achieve organizational goals. A leader is an individual who has the capacity to influence the behavior of others and also holds a central position in leadership situations (Genty, 2014). Leadership plays a significant role in an organization by developing a mission, vision and establishing ideas, designing strategies, developing policies and methods so as to achieve the organizational objectives efficiently as well as directing and coordinating efforts and activities of the organization (Xu and Wang, 2008, cited by Ebrahim, 2018). According to Burian, Francis, Burian and Pieffer (2014), 'Leadership is the blending of vision, and contribution to society, turning ideas into reality through others that share the same vision.' An organization needs well competent, capable and skilled workforce in order to achieve the organizations' strategic goals and employees do have the ability to increase or decrease the productivity and profitability of an organization and so in order to achieve their goals leadership style is believed to be a factor that can influence employee's efficiency at work (Muhammad, Qin, Amir and Aruba, 2017).A good leader is able to make a success out of a poor business plan while a poor leader can make a failure of a good business plan, as leadership ability brings valuable asset to an organization which can improve an organization's growth and revenue generation which will result out of the organization spending so much on the subject of leadership training and development (Kemal, 2015). However, good leadership is essential for an organization to attain its mission, goals and objectives as well as manage the changes happening in the external environment. It is believed that a lot of organizations are faced with problems related to unethical practices, high labor turn-over, poor performances amongst others, which may be as a result of poor leadership style (Ebrahim, 2018).'Leadership brings in a required change to influence learning and development of required skills, performance and creates a platform for individual growth in an organization' (Sunil, 2018). This results into a need for effective leaders that are able to recognize the difficulties of the fast-changing global environment and equally know what to do.
